Kohali - Kalameshwar, Nagpur

Kohali is a village situated in the Kalameshwar tehsil of Nagpur district, Maharashtra. It is located approximately 12 km from the tehsil headquarters in Kalameshwar and around 36 km from the district headquarters in Nagpur. Kohali village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Kohali is 535126. The village covers a total geographical area of 527.85 hectares and falls under the 441502 pincode. Mohpa is the nearest town, located about 7 km away.

Kohali village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Savner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Ramtek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Kohali

As per Census 2011, Kohali village has a total population of 2,192 people, consisting of 1,091 males and 1,101 females. The village has 582 households and a sex ratio of 1,009 females per 1,000 males. There are 200 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,663 literate and 529 illiterate residents. Additionally, 542 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 124 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Kohali

Kohali is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Kohli, while the nearest airport is Dr. Babasaheb Ambedkar International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 24.1 km.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Mohpa to Kohali is about 7 km, with a usual travel time of around 15-30 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Nagpur to Kohali is about 36 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
